Anxiety disorders can come in an array of different shapes and sizes. OCD, specifically, leads to unwanted thoughts and compulsions performed in an attempt to relieve anxiety from distress caused by the thought. People without OCD often describe it incorrectly - labeling it as someone with type A personality. In reality, it is a chronic and debilitating disorder when left untreated. Education of the different OCD subtypes helps prevent stigma and raise awareness. In this episode, Katie and Cali debunk stigma and talk about the taboo subtypes of OCD such as harm OCD and sexual intrusive thoughts.
